After a four-year break, the Deodhar Trophy – final held in 2019-20- returns to the Indian cricketing calendar, with the match set to kick off on Monday right here on the Cricket Association of Pondicherry grounds.

Like the Duleep Trophy, the one-day match reverts to a zonal format, with the six groups enjoying one another as soon as in a round-robin format on alternate days beginning Monday earlier than the highest two combat for the title on August 3.

At a time when one-day cricket is combating for relevance, this version of the Deodhar Trophy may need a small function contemplating it’s a World Cup yr.

Though it’s understood that the selectors have shortlisted 20 gamers for the celebrated occasion, the match presents gamers within the fringes beneath to point out what they’ll do and make a last-minute impression in case a spot is offered nearer to the occasion.

With the Vijay Hazare Trophy set to be held solely after the World Cup, the subsequent two weeks might turn into essential for gamers and the selectors to finalise backup choices.

Some of the gamers to be careful for embody the likes of pacer Shivam Mavi, all-rounder Venkatesh Iyer, Rinku Singh, and Washington Sundar, who was a part of the one-day set-up as not too long ago because the three-match collection towards Australia earlier this yr.

“If a player can have an extraordinary tournament, you never know, an opportunity to play in the World Cup is looming ahead or even long-term get into the one-day squad,” mentioned Central Zone skipper Venkatesh.

As for the match, most groups are evenly matched with gamers who’ve carried out effectively in final yr’s Vijay Hazare match and the IPL, discovering a spot of their respective zonal squads.

The Mayank Agarwal-led South Zone facet – which gained the Duleep Trophy final week – and West Zone will begin the match as favourites with some pedigreed gamers of their line-up.

However, the groups had solely sooner or later of correct follow after persistent drizzle on Sunday pressured gamers to the indoor nets, the place the batters took some throwdowns, and some spinners rolled their arms over.

Monday’s matches: West Zone vs North East Zone, CAP Ground 2 (9 a.m.); East Zone vs Central Zone, CAP Ground 3 (9 a.m.); *North Zone vs South Zone (1.30 p.m.), Siechem Stadium.
